ADAPTATION OF THE SPANISH HIGH EDUCATION TO THE EUROPEAN HIGHER EDUCATION AREA (EHEA)

3 main lines >

The new structure of the academic degrees, The use of the ECTS (European Credit Transfer System) as the

measure of the teaching effort of the students, The development of new approaches of innovative teaching

oriented to increase the participation of the students in the teaching/learning process.

CONSIDERATIONS ON THE INFORMATICS ENGINEERING DEGREE

ANECA > White Paper for the Informatics Engineering degree

Unique degree 240 ECTS [4 years, 60 ECTS per year] General education on informatics with some specialities

Master degree 60 to 120 ECTS [1 or 2 years] oriented to professional specialities, research, and the PhD

THE PROJECT OF ADAPTATION TO THE EHEA AT FIV-UPV

Aim > Develop actions to spread and discuss the process to adapt to the EHEA

Institutional context to develop preliminary experiences to implant ECTS and new teaching and evaluation methodologies

3 main goals >

To collect information from other Schools and Faculties about teaching and ECTS related to the approach to EHEA.

To do a teaching research about methodologies and dedication for teachers and students.

To obtain a model compound of well defined criteria for adapting to EHEA the Informatics Engineering degree of the Faculty of Computer Science.

Teaching innovation >

Discussion about previous experiences in the Faculty of Computer Science about teaching organization, methodologies, and evaluation

In most cases, the group size was the most important factor for the success

Teaching methods based on projects for the students, seminars, and non-present work, are only bearable when the number of students is small (about 30 students per group)
